Release Date and Operating System
The Galaxy S5 Duos was originally released in 2014, featuring the Android 4.4.2 operating system with the TouchWiz UI. While it may not run on the latest Android software, the device still offers a smooth and user-friendly interface.
Design and Dimensions
Weighing in at 145g and with a thickness of 8.1mm, the Galaxy S5 Duos is a lightweight and slim device that is comfortable to hold and use. It also features an IP67 rating, making it dust and water-resistant for up to 1m for 30 minutes.
Display and Platform
The Galaxy S5 Duos boasts a stunning Super AMOLED display with a size of 5.1 inches, offering a screen-to-body ratio of 69.6%. The 1080 x 1920 pixel resolution with a 16:9 aspect ratio and Corning Gorilla Glass 3 protection ensures a sharp and vibrant display. It runs on the Android 4.4.2 (KitKat) OS with TouchWiz UI, powered by a Qualcomm Snapdragon 801 chipset and a quad-core 2.5 GHz Krait 400 CPU.
Storage and Memory
The device comes with 16GB of internal storage and is expandable with a microSDXC card slot. It also has 2GB of RAM, providing ample storage space and smooth multitasking capabilities.
Main Camera and Selfie Camera
The Galaxy S5 Duos sports a 16MP main camera with features such as LED flash, panorama, and HDR. It can shoot high-quality videos in 4K at 30fps and 1080p at 60fps with HDR. The front-facing selfie camera has 2MP and offers dual video call capabilities.
Sound and Connectivity
With a loudspeaker and a 3.5mm headphone jack, the Galaxy S5 Duos also boasts 24-bit/192kHz audio for a superior sound experience. It offers various connectivity options such as Wi-Fi 802.11 a/b/g/n/ac, Bluetooth 4.0, GPS, NFC, and a microUSB 3.0 port.
Battery Life and Other Features
The device is powered by a removable Li-Ion 2800 mAh battery, providing decent battery life for everyday use. It also includes features such as an infrared port, MHL 2.1 TV-out, and OTG support.
